How updating a post can influence seo
-
I have just read this great post from moz blog: http://moz.com/blog/google-fresh-factor
But I haven't found nothing about updating post date.
If I edit an old great post (now ranked 2nd after several months in 1st serp position) does it be better if I also update the date of the post in the wordpress post edit page?

ForForce is spot on.
Trust is a critical factor. Instead of artificially manipulating the post date, be sure the "date last updated" is accurately working.
And if you DO make a value-add update to a post, add a sentence to the top of the post like "Update: ________" and maybe even put "Updated" with the date right in the page Title or meta Description.
Anything else would be playing with fire.

For google rankings it's going to depend more on the update than the post-date.
For example, if you have a 10 paragraph post, and you add 1 paragraph and change the post date, I doubt you would regain the 1st position.
If you add 5 new paragraphs that add more detail or broader coverage to the subject and change the post date, you have a pretty good chance.
In both cases, you are not likely to get any kind of penalty for changing the post date.
On the other hand.... If you make a habit of REGULARLY updating post dates without providing any new value to the reader, then google will see this RECURRING behavior as spammy, and you'd probably end up on page 2 instead of position 2.
For the best ranking results I'd suggest you aim to update the article with a minimum of 20% new valuable content and update the post date. Possibly stick the word 'Updated: ' before the original title of the post as well.
